The Smart windshield is one of the most distinctive pieces of glass on the road. Because Smart vehicles were engineered around a Tridion safety cell, the windshield is bonded directly to that reinforced frame, which means the urethane adhesive is doing more than just holding glass in place. It is actively reinforcing the car's safety envelope. A Smart car windshield replacement is not just about installing a clear piece of glass. It is about preserving the structural integrity that makes the vehicle safe to drive, and that is why we never cut corners on adhesive curing time or installation procedure.
Smart vehicles feature an oversized, steeply raked windshield that takes up an unusually large portion of the front silhouette. This design choice gives Smart drivers excellent visibility, but it also means the windshield is exposed to a wider area of impact from road debris, hail, and weather. The steep rake angle also means that even small chips can develop into long horizontal cracks faster than they would on a more upright windshield, because the glass takes on more vibration stress as the body flexes over bumps and expansion joints.

Not every chip or crack requires full replacement, but Smart windshields tend to reach the replacement threshold faster than many other vehicles because of the curvature and the large surface area exposed to stress. Knowing when to repair and when to replace can save you time, money, and a much larger headache down the road.
Any crack longer than about three inches, any crack that crosses the driver's primary line of sight, and any crack that reaches the edge of the windshield should be considered a replacement situation. On a Smart car, edge cracks are particularly common because the glass is bonded so close to the Tridion cell. Once a crack reaches that bond line, the structural seal is compromised and repair is no longer a safe or legal option.
Star breaks, bullseyes, and combination breaks larger than a quarter usually cannot be repaired in a way that fully restores optical clarity, especially on the steeply raked Smart windshield where any imperfection sits directly in your field of vision. If you have taken a hard impact and you can see the damage from the driver's seat, a Smart windshield replacement is the right call.
Smart vehicles are known for developing stress cracks that seem to appear out of nowhere, often starting at the bottom corners of the windshield and traveling inward. These are usually the result of small chips that were not addressed in time, combined with the natural flex of the chassis. Once a stress crack forms, there is no safe repair, and the only correct fix is a full windshield replacement.

Most Smart windshield replacements are completed in 30 to 45 minutes, with an additional one hour of safe drive-away time to allow the urethane adhesive to fully cure.
Once your appointment is scheduled, our mobile technician arrives at your home, office, or any other convenient location with the correct OEM-quality glass already in hand. We begin by protecting the surrounding paint and interior with covers, then carefully remove your existing Smart windshield using cold-knife or wire-out techniques designed to preserve the pinch weld. We prep the bonding surface, prime any exposed metal, lay down a fresh bead of high-grade urethane adhesive, and set the new windshield with precise alignment. Any moldings, sensors, mirrors, and trim are then reinstalled to factory specifications. Once the install is complete, we walk you through the one-hour cure window and provide care instructions.

Newer Smart EQ Fortwo and Forfour models, particularly those equipped with the optional driver assistance package, include forward-facing cameras and rain or light sensors mounted directly to the windshield. When the windshield is replaced, these sensors must be remounted with proper gel pads and, in some cases, the camera system must be recalibrated to ensure that lane keeping, forward collision warning, and automatic headlight features continue to operate correctly. After your Smart windshield replacement, there are a few simple steps you can take to make sure the new glass and adhesive cure properly and last for the long haul. Avoid slamming your doors for the first 24 hours, since the pressure changes can disturb the fresh urethane seal. Leave the retention tape in place for at least one full day. Avoid car washes, especially high-pressure ones, for the first 48 hours. And try not to park on extremely uneven surfaces during the first day so the body of the car is not flexing while the adhesive sets.
